Do you have questions about the ideal tank size for your roof area and your individual usage? Feel free to use our rainwater planner. How does garden irrigation work with the "AKTION" garden system? Rainwater flows from the roof through the gutter grate (which acts as a pre-filter), then down the downspout and through the inlet surge arrester into the flat tank. The automatic submersible pressure pump located in the tank is connected to the water connection box via a hose that runs through a conduit. When the valve in the box is opened, the pump starts automatically. Closing the valve causes the submersible pressure pump to shut off on its own. You can install the water connection box wherever is convenient for you. When the cistern is full, the rainwater drains off via the overflow siphon. The barrier integrated here prevents small animals from entering. If there is a risk of frost, the pump must be disconnected from the power supply and the valve on the water connection box must remain open. Please contact service@greenlife.de or our customer service at 0385 77 337 72 (weekdays 8 a.m.–4 p.m.). The entire system must be checked regularly for leaks, cleanliness, and stability. Maintenance of the entire system should be performed at intervals of approximately 5 years—every 10 years if a GreenLife Biovitor is used in accordance with the instructions. During this process, the system components must be cleaned and checked for proper function. Maintenance should be performed as follows:Empty the tank completelyRemove solid residues with a soft spatulaClean surfaces and internal components with waterCompletely remove dirt from the tankCheck that all internal components are securely fastened

If you have any questions, please contact us at info@greenlife.de.How the drinking water treatment system works Rainwater treatment is chemical-free: After mechanical filtration, bacteria, germs, and viruses are rendered harmless through UV disinfection. The system is characterized by exceptionally high disinfection efficiency combined with a compact design and low energy consumption. First, the rainwater is directed to the tank (cistern). Whenever possible, only roof runoff water should be used, as—unlike with yard and driveway surfaces—relatively low levels of contamination are expected. If leaf fall is anticipated, please use gutter screens or similar devices to prevent leaves from entering the tank. For optimal pre-filtration in the (rainwater) tank, we recommend using our fully biological rainwater filter BIOVITOR.The pre-filtered rainwater is transported from the cistern to the UV 2000 drinking water treatment system via the GUP 46 submersible pressure pump. There, it first passes through two sediment filters (20 µm and 10 µm), then an activated carbon filter, and finally undergoes UV disinfection: The water to be treated flows through the housing and is directed along the quartz immersion tube in which the lamp is mounted. The thin water film thickness of only 7.5 mm (referring here to the distance between the UV light exit on the quartz tube surface and the inner wall of the housing) ensures optimal penetration of the medium by the UV light. The maximum treatment capacity of the drinking water treatment system is 2,000 liters per hour. Maintenance and Care Instructions for the UV 2000 Treatment System The special UV lamps should be replaced after 10,000 operating hours; otherwise, the disinfection rate will decrease. The UV lamp can be switched off when the system is not in use. The compact design allows for easy, tool-free lamp removal and replacement, e.g., at the end of the lamp’s service life. For cleaning purposes, the quartz immersion tube can also be removed or installed without tools. The filter cartridges for sediment filtration and the activated carbon filter should be replaced as needed, but at least every 4 months.You can order the set of replacement filters for up to one year of water treatment from our shop.In addition, for your own safety, quality samples of the filtered water should be taken and tested at regular intervals. How reverse osmosis works In reverse osmosis, water is forced under pressure through a semipermeable membrane. Even the finest dissolved substances, ions, and microorganisms are retained in the process. The result is high-purity water of outstanding quality with significantly reduced conductivity. DetailsFor filtering rainwater. The filter is installed inside the cistern or tank directly between the inlet and overflow. The height difference between these connections is at least 30 mm. The filter contains a slotted screen with a mesh size of 0.8 mm, through which purified water flows vertically into the tank. During heavy rain or when the water level is very high, dirt particles are removed from the surface of the screen. Thanks to this self-cleaning effect, maintenance is less frequent than with basket filters. Suitable for surface drainage up to 160 m². A hook for lifting the filter is included.Technical Data Material: PolyethyleneWeight: 2.35 kgLength: 500 mmWidth: 195 mmHeight: 350 mm

DetailsSystem for collecting clean rainwater for use in washing machines, garden irrigation, and toilet flushing. Rainwater is collected in an underground tank made of high-quality plastic, drawn in by a self-priming centrifugal pump, and pumped to the points of use. If there is a shortage of rainwater, a solenoid valve switches to a direct supply of drinking water.Scope of deliveryUnderground tank made of high-quality polyethyleneSliding dome with plastic safety cover (walkable up to 200 kg)Biovitor with inlet flow regulatorOverflow siphon with small animal protectionRainwater manager GRM2.0 with multi-stage self-priming centrifugal pump for drinking water replenishmentFloat switch with 20 m connection cable and adjustment weightLabeling materials

DetailsDevice for refilling the cistern with drinking water. As the water level in the rainwater cistern drops, a solenoid valve is opened via the float switch and drinking water is added. Scope of delivery Solenoid valve DN 13 with connection cable and plug 3/4" threaded connection Float switch with 20 m cable Adapter plug and weightBall valveFlexible reinforced hoseHigh-pressure pipe, 30 cm
